Overview
The Product Management AD (Technology) is a key leadership role responsible for driving technology execution across a portfolio of enterprise SaaS solutions. This role partners closely with Product Management and Engineering leadership to translate product strategy into scalable, secure, and high-performing technology solutions. The Associate Director will lead multiple development teams, champion modern software development practices, and play a critical role in advancing AI-enabled capabilities—both within internal development processes and customer-facing products. This position requires a strong balance of technology leadership, operational execution, and innovation mindset to support high-growth, mission-critical solutions in a regulated industry environment.

Company Overview
Wolters Kluwer (EURONEXT: WKL) is a global leader in professional information, software solutions, and services for the healthcare, tax and accounting, financial and corporate compliance, legal and regulatory, and corporate performance and ESG sectors. We help our customers make important decisions every day by providing expert solutions that combine deep domain knowledge with specialized technology and services.
Wolters Kluwer reported 2022 annual revenues of €5.5 billion. The group serves customers in over 180 countries, maintains operations in over 40 countries, and employs approximately 20,000 people worldwide. We are headquartered in Alphen aan den Rijn, the Netherlands.
